Why the Interest in USDT to TRX?
The appeal of swapping USDT for TRX isn’t simply about chasing the best exchange rate. It’s about leveraging the strengths of both currencies. USDT, as a stablecoin, offers a haven from the volatility that often plagues other cryptocurrencies. It’s a digital dollar, providing a reliable store of value. TRX, on the other hand, is built on the Tron network, renowned for its high transaction speeds and low fees.
Think of it like this: you might hold USDT for long-term stability, but when you need to make frequent, small transactions – perhaps within a decentralized application (dApp) on the Tron blockchain – converting to TRX becomes incredibly efficient. The Tron network’s gas fees, typically paid in TRX, are significantly lower than those on Ethereum, making it a cost-effective choice for everyday use.
The Global Context: Ukraine, India, and Beyond
The demand for USDT and its conversion to TRX isn’t happening in a vacuum. Recent events have highlighted its importance in various geopolitical contexts. For example, during the ongoing conflict in Ukraine, USDT’s price surged on local exchanges like Kuna, reaching as high as 36.97 Ukrainian hryvnia. This demonstrates its role as a lifeline in times of crisis, providing access to funds when traditional financial systems are disrupted.
Similarly, in India, regulatory uncertainty surrounding USDT has led to price volatility, creating opportunities for savvy traders to profit from arbitrage. This underscores the importance of understanding the regulatory landscape in your region before engaging in any crypto transactions.

How to Make the Swap
Swapping USDT to TRX is surprisingly straightforward. Here’s a basic outline:
- Choose an Exchange: Select a reputable cryptocurrency exchange that supports both USDT and TRX. ChangeNOW is one example.
- Enter Recipient Address: Carefully input the TRX wallet address where you want to receive the converted tokens. Double-check this address – errors can be costly!
- Send USDT Deposit: Deposit the amount of USDT you wish to convert.
- Receive TRX: The exchange will process your request, and the equivalent amount of TRX will be sent to your wallet.
Remember to factor in any exchange fees or commissions when calculating the final amount of TRX you’ll receive.
